The complete collection of scanned Pascal User's Group newsletters
have been placed online on the standard Pascal web site:
www.moorecad.com/standardpascal
The PUG newsletters were produced between 1974 and 1983. Those years
date from the second revision of original Pascal to the ISO and ANSI
standards for the language.
The newsletters include interesting commentary and history of Pascal,
as well as many large programs written in the original standard Pascal.
Previously these newsletters were discussed, but not obtainable. Until
now. These newsletters were scanned into .PDF format, with "editable
text", meaning they can have the OCRed text copied from them to
other do***ents (for example, to extract a program from the text).
Many of these programs showed up later, modified for UCSD Pascal, in
the USUS (UCSD Users Society) newsletters.
This is part of an ongoing effort by me to collect im****tant articles,
history and programs applying to Wirth's original Pascal language.
